04911 PWL-GZB EXP SPL

04911 PWL-GZB EXP SPL is a mail/express service from Palwal (PWL) to Ghaziabad (GZB). It covers 80 km in 2 hr 35 min, calling at 17 stations and spending 1 night on board. It runs every day of the week.

Mail/Express · 80 km · 2 hr 35 min · 17 stops · Daily
